Bernard Cohn is a scholar working on Political Science and International Relations, Sociology and Political Science and Anthropology. According to data from OpenAlex, Bernard Cohn has authored 31 papers receiving a total of 1.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Political Science and International Relations, 6 papers in Sociology and Political Science and 6 papers in Anthropology. Recurrent topics in Bernard Cohn’s work include South Asian Studies and Conflicts (8 papers), Politics and Conflicts in Afghanistan, Pakistan, and Middle East (5 papers) and Southeast Asian Sociopolitical Studies (4 papers). Bernard Cohn is often cited by papers focused on South Asian Studies and Conflicts (8 papers), Politics and Conflicts in Afghanistan, Pakistan, and Middle East (5 papers) and Southeast Asian Sociopolitical Studies (4 papers). Bernard Cohn collaborates with scholars based in United States. Bernard Cohn's co-authors include Milton Singer, McKim Marriott, M. N. Srinivas, Verrier Elwin and E. Kathleen Gough and has published in prestigious journals such as Contemporary Sociology A Journal of Reviews, American Sociological Review and The American Historical Review.
